Mathematics JAMB 2024

Differentiate Cos25º – Sin 25º

 

  • - ( Sin25º + Cos25º) checkmark
  • - ( Sec25 + Cot25)
  • - ( Cot25 + Sec25)
  • - ( Sin25 + Sec25)

The correct answer is: A

Explanation

Cos25º - Sin 25º

The differentiation of a constant = 0, But based on the Options provided

Cos 25º when differentiated = -Sin 25º and Sin25º = + Cos25º

Putting these together, we have - Sin25º - Cos25º = - ( Sin25º + Cos25º)
